How does the trash can design address the challenge of wind-blown debris accumulation?
Wind-blown debris is a common challenge in outdoor waste management, but modern trash can designs offer effective solutions. Here’s how innovative designs tackle this issue:
1. Weighted Bases: Many outdoor bins feature heavy or anchored bases to prevent tipping and keep debris from scattering in strong winds.
2. Lid Mechanisms: Secure, self-closing lids or hinged covers minimize exposure, reducing the chance of lightweight trash escaping.
3. Ventilation Control: Strategically placed vents allow airflow without creating suction that could pull debris out of the bin.
4. Low-Profile Openings: Designs with narrower openings or inward-sloping rims help contain waste while discouraging wind entry.
5. Durable Materials: Sturdy, wind-resistant materials like reinforced plastic or metal ensure bins withstand gusts without deformation.
6. Internal Liners: Some models include weighted or fitted liners to keep bags in place, preventing them from being dislodged by wind.
7. Aerodynamic Shapes: Rounded or tapered designs deflect wind rather than catching it, reducing the risk of toppling.
By combining these features, modern trash cans maintain cleanliness in parks, streets, and public spaces—even in windy conditions. Municipalities and property managers increasingly prioritize such designs to cut litter-related maintenance costs and uphold environmental standards.
